WebEOPS/CARE is a state-funded retention and support program designed to facilitate the success of the financially and educationally disadvantaged student. Services provided by … WebEOPS is a state funded program which is designed to go above and beyond other services offered on campus. It is a program created to support students who are economically disadvantaged and have lacked access to educational opportunities Services We Offer: How Do I Qualify?
